Cars from all the major manufactures including Jaguar, Ferrari, Aston Martin, Mercedes, BMW and MINI were on display in various locations around the streets of Shrewsbury town centre.

The event also helped raise money for charity, drink company Gatorade hosted a ‘Power Pull’ event in The Square.

Contestants paid £1.00 to take part in a timed effort to pull the Gatorade car, with a host of prizes for the person with the fastest time, and money raised split between Hope House and Severn Hospice.

Event organiser Craig Petty, dealer principal of Hatfields Jaguar took part in the “Power Pull” with a time of 25 seconds.

Shrewsbury Mayor, Cllr Jon Tandy, said: “It was a great day for Shrewsbury, I heard so many fantastic comments and the town had a real buzz about it.

“My thanks go to all those involved in putting another great event onto the calendar for Shrewsbury.”
